GENERAL
Battery Voltage: 12 / 24 / 48V Auto Select (software tool needed to select 36V)
Rated Charge Current: 100A
Nominal PV Power, 12V (1a,b): 1450W
Nominal PV Power, 24V (1a,b): 2900W
Nominal PV Power, 36V (1a,b): 4350W
Nominal PV Power, 48V (1a,b): 5800W
Max. PV Short Circuit Current (2): 70A
Maximum PV Open Circuit Voltage: 250V absolute maximum coldest conditions, 245V start-up and operating maximum
Maximum Efficiency: 99%
Self-Consumption: Less than 35mA @ 12V / 20mA @ 48V
Charge Voltage 'absorption': Default setting: 14.4 / 28.8 / 43.2 / 57.6V (adjustable with: rotary switch, display, VE.Direct or Bluetooth)
Charge Voltage 'float': Default setting: 13.8 / 27.6 / 41.4 / 55.2V (adjustable: rotary switch, display, VE.Direct or Bluetooth)
Charge Voltage 'equalization': Default setting: 16.2V / 32.4V / 48.6V / 64.8V (adjustable)
Charge Algorithm: multi-stage adaptive (eight preprogrammed algorithms) or user defined algorithm
Temperature Compensation: -16 mV / -32 mV / -64 mV / °C
Protection: PV reverse polarity / Output short circuit / Over temperature
Operating Temperature: -30 to +60°C (full rated output up to 40°C)
Humidity: 95%, non-condensing
Maximum Altitude: 5000m (full rated output up to 2000m)
Environmental Condition: Indoor, unconditioned
Pollution Degree: PD3
Data Communication Port: VE.Direct or Bluetooth
Remote On/Off: Yes (2 pole connector)
Programmable Relay DPST AC Rating: 240VAC / 4A
Programmable Relay DPST DC Rating: 4A up to 35VDC, 1A up to 60VDC
Parallel Operation: Yes
ENCLOSURE
Colour: Blue (RAL 5012)
PV Terminals (3): 35 mm² / AWG2
Battery Terminals: 35mm² / AWG2
Protection Category: IP43 (electronic components), IP22 (connection area)
Weight: 4.5kg
Dimensions: (h x w x d) 216 x 295 x 103mm
STANDARDS
Safety: EN/IEC 62109-1, UL 1741, CSA C22.2
(1a) If more PV power is connected, the controller will limit input power.
(1b) The PV voltage must exceed Vbat + 5V for the controller to start. Thereafter the minimum PV voltage is Vbat + 1V.
(2) A PV array with a higher short circuit current may damage the controller.
(3) MC4 models: several splitter pairs may be needed to parallel the strings of solar panels Maximum current per MC4 connector: 30A (the MC4 connectors are parallel connected to one MPPT tracker)
